Description
Utilize jelly glue technology to deliver comfort, aesthetics, and versatility. Keduo's silicone underwear is environmentally friendly and odorless, boasting excellent adhesion and ductility, and withstands repeated stretching without deforming. It also offers a wide temperature resistance range (-60°C to 200°C) and soft support technology for seamless comfort while providing a contouring and shaping effect.
